Onboarding — Brambleway stale-branch cleanup bot, notes for external plugin authors. The bot scans repositories nightly, flags branches idle past sixty days, and opens a grace-period issue before deletion; plugins can extend the grace window or exempt branches via the policy hook, but must respond within two seconds or the default applies. Deleted branches are archived as bundles for ninety days, so recovery is always possible. To authorize your plugin against the archive restore endpoint in the sandbox, enter the recovery passphrase below.

unlock words, bahop-fawef: novmir-druwyn-soriel-rusdor-kasion

// REINDEX_BATCH_CAP limits docs per shard pass in the Tallowfield
// nightly search reindex. Raising it starves the ingest queue;
// lowering it overruns the maintenance window. 5000 is the tested
// sweet spot. Change only with a soak run. Verified against the
// build noted below.

session token of bawif-hahog = htk6_ac5981

Subject: Heads up — clock skew biting the build agents again

Hey folks (especially the new joiners),

If you see artifacts timestamped in the future, don't panic — agents in the Torvale pool drifted about 90 seconds and the cache keys got confused. We've re-synced them and requeued affected jobs. If your build still looks stale, retrigger it and check it against the token below.

build token for kagup-kagug: htk9_1a9a918d7

## After-Hours Server Room Access

Contractors working past 7pm at the Halverton site: the server room on Level 2 locks automatically once the day shift leaves. Don't prop the door — alarms go off, and Facilities will not be thrilled. Sign the late-work log at the hub desk first, then enter using the code below.

turnstile pass: bdg-YPPQB-52010

Ticket: BNC-2190 — Bounce processor drifted from baseline

Future maintainers, learn from our pain: the Mailwren bounce processor on the two worker boxes no longer matches what's in version control. Retry caps differ between hosts, and one box is classifying soft bounces as hard, which quietly nuked a chunk of a customer list. Please treat the repo as the source of truth and reconcile. What's actually running right now is the following.

config for badup-kagap:
OLIOX_PIN=5344
OLIOX_METRICS_HOST=metrics.oliox.zemvarcorp.corp
OLIOX_LOG_LEVEL=error
OLIOX_TENANT=pelox